Shang-Chi garners 5 nominations for Critics Choice Super Awards

Shang-Chi and the Legend of the Ten Rings wasn’t just a hit with fans. It’s also a hit with critics.

The Critics Choice Association honored the first Marvel film to feature a predominantly Asian cast with 5 Super Awards nominations, reported the Daily News.

Stars Tony Leung and Simu Liu will face off against each other for Best Actor in a Superhero Movie. Leung also received a nomination for Best Villain.

Michelle Yeoh received recognition in the Best Actress in a Superhero Movie category and the Critics Association named the movie in the category of Best Superhero Movies.

Shang-Chi tied for most nominations with Spider-Man No Way Home.

“Every single nomination is so well-deserved…except mine,” said Liu on Twitter. What were they thinking. No, seriously, it’s a huge honor, but HOW. So proud of our amazing cast and everyone who came out to watch the film. I really hope Tony wins everything.:

The winners will be announced on March 17, reported the Belfast Telegraph.
